Abstract
The leaching, precipitation and flotation method of recovering metals from ores is simplified by carrying out the leaching and precipitation steps simultaneously in the same reaction vessel. The method is particularly useful for recovering metals from low grade ores. During the leaching and precipitation step, mechanical comminution of the ore is also effected. The preferred reaction vessel is oscillated and the leaching and precipitation process is continuously effected by passage of the materials through the reaction vessel. The method is particularly suitable for recovering copper from oxygen containing copper ores.
